Hi! My name is Morgana (she/her). While I used to work promoting peacebuilding, resilience, and trauma healing on a larger scale in the international development space, I transitioned to being a therapist because I love partnering with people directly to promote their mental health and wellbeing. I believe in the power of individual healing and its role as a critical part of broader family, community, and societal healing.

I have extensive experience working with individuals and families with complex trauma histories and draw on a variety of approaches—including mindfulness, cognitive behavioral therapy, dialectical behavioral therapy, internal family systems, and somatic exercises—to respond to each person’s preferences and needs.

Sharing is not easy; I aim to create a safe space for you to feel comfortable to do the sort of vulnerable self- exploration involved in the therapeutic process. Becoming a parent is such a huge and transformational transition—it can bring up a lot and be a wonderfully potent time to reflect and grow in preparation for welcoming your little one. I know from my own experience, healing is hard, but by showing yourself that love and care, you strengthen your capacity to offer it to others as well.

In addition to individual counseling, I am also passionate about working with couples and families to explore how together they can best create a positive environment to support each family member’s wellbeing.

Each person is different and is on their own unique journey; I’d be honored to support you on yours.
